Why Internal Injuries After a Slip and Fall Are Dangerous

Internal injuries affect organs, blood vessels, or tissues inside the body. Because they are not visible, people often assume they are fine and delay medical attention. This delay can allow internal bleeding, swelling, or organ damage to worsen over time.

Slip and fall accidents can generate enough force to damage internal organs, especially when a person falls from a height, strikes a hard surface, or lands awkwardly. Older adults and people with underlying health conditions may be at higher risk.

Common Types of Internal Injuries Caused by Slip and Fall Accidents

Several types of internal injuries may result from a slip and fall accident.

Internal Bleeding

Internal bleeding occurs when blood vessels are damaged and blood collects inside the body. This can happen in the abdomen, chest, or around the brain. Internal bleeding is especially dangerous because it may not be immediately apparent.

Organ Damage

A hard impact can injure organs such as the liver, spleen, kidneys, or lungs. Organ damage may interfere with normal bodily functions and often requires prompt medical treatment.

Traumatic Brain Injuries

A blow to the head during a fall can cause internal brain injuries, including concussions or more severe traumatic brain injuries. These injuries may occur even if there is no visible head wound.

Signs and Symptoms of Internal Injuries

Symptoms of internal injuries can vary depending on the area of the body affected. Some warning signs may appear immediately, while others develop hours or days later.

Abdominal Pain or Swelling

Persistent or worsening pain in the abdomen may signal internal bleeding or organ damage. Swelling, tenderness, or a feeling of fullness can also be warning signs.

Dizziness or Fainting

Feeling lightheaded, dizzy, or faint may indicate internal bleeding or a drop in blood pressure. These symptoms should never be ignored after a fall.

Shortness of Breath or Chest Pain

Difficulty breathing, chest pain, or rapid breathing may suggest lung injuries or internal bleeding in the chest. These symptoms can become severe quickly.

Nausea or Vomiting

Nausea, vomiting, or vomiting blood may be associated with internal organ injuries or head trauma.

Severe Headaches or Confusion

Persistent headaches, confusion, memory problems, or changes in behavior may point to a traumatic brain injury. These symptoms can worsen over time if untreated.

Bruising That Spreads or Worsens

Large or expanding bruises, especially around the abdomen or torso, can be a sign of internal bleeding beneath the skin.

Why You Should Seek Medical Attention After a Slip and Fall

Even if you feel fine after a slip and fall accident, a medical evaluation is important. Doctors can use imaging tests and examinations to detect internal injuries that are not visible from the outside.

Early diagnosis can prevent complications, reduce recovery time, and protect your long-term health. Medical records also create important documentation if the fall occurred due to unsafe property conditions.
